AI Python Engineer - Langchain LLMs - Clinical Data

Posted last month

Worldwide

Summary

ABOUT CITEMED CiteMed is a globally distributed team on a mission to improve clinical regulatory workflows. We move fast, we respect each other, and we trust people to own their work. If you thrive with autonomy and care about the impact of what you build, you’ll fit right in. We’re a small but growing distributed team — scrappy, fast-moving, and genuinely collaborative. There’s no bureaucracy to navigate, no waiting for permission — just smart people moving quickly toward something that matters. For the right person, this role has real room to grow. ABOUT THIS ROLE We have a production AI system built on LangChain and LangGraph that extracts structured clinical data from PDF research articles. It’s a core part of how Evidence Cloud — our regulatory compliance platform — works. We need a developer who can own this system, improve it, and scale it as the product grows. This is not a ticket-taker role. We want someone who understands the architecture, cares about how the code is written, and brings ideas to the table. If you’ve shipped real AI systems and can prove it, we want to talk to you. WHAT YOU’LL ACTUALLY WORK ON • Own and maintain our LangChain/LangGraph extraction workflows in production • Process complex PDFs — dense tables, figures, multi-column layouts, and clinical research formats that break standard parsers • Extract and structure clinical and medical data with high accuracy — the output feeds directly into regulatory submissions • Architect systems that are clean, maintainable, and built to scale as the codebase grows • Identify bottlenecks, failure points, and improvement opportunities — and bring solutions, not just observations • Collaborate with our product and dev team to integrate extraction workflows into the broader Evidence Cloud platform • Document your work clearly so the system is understandable and handoff-ready YOU’RE PROBABLY A GOOD FIT IF… • You have strong Python engineering skills and you care about clean architecture — messy code that works isn’t good enough for you • You have hands-on, production experience with LangChain and/or LangGraph — not just tutorials • You’ve dealt with the hard parts of PDF processing: irregular layouts, embedded tables, scanned documents, inconsistent formatting • You’ve shipped real AI systems and have the GitHub or demo to prove it • You work autonomously, communicate proactively, and don’t need to be chased for updates • You think about systems holistically — not just the feature in front of you, but how it fits into the broader architecture • Bonus: you have experience with clinical, medical, or regulatory data — you understand what a clinical evaluation report is and why accuracy matters HOW WE’LL MEASURE SUCCESS • Code quality: Clean, maintainable architecture that scales as the codebase grows • Extraction accuracy: High-accuracy structured data output from complex clinical PDFs • System reliability: Production system stable, well-documented, and handoff-ready • Proactive improvement: Identifies and flags issues, bottlenecks, and opportunities before being asked • Communication: Weekly updates via Slack — what shipped, what’s in progress, what’s blocked TO APPLY • Include the following with your application — applications without these will not be reviewed: • GitHub profile or relevant repositories showing production-quality Python and LLM work • At least one live demo or project walkthrough showcasing PDF processing, LLM pipelines, or similar work

  • More than 30 hrs/week
    Hourly
  • 6+ months
    Duration
  • Expert
    Experience Level
  • $20.00

    -

    $55.00

    Hourly
  • Remote Job
  • Ongoing project
    Project Type
Skills and Expertise
Mandatory skills
Python
Data Science
Artificial Intelligence
Activity on this job
  • Proposals:50+
  • Last viewed by client:3 weeks ago
  • Interviewing:
    11
  • Invites sent:
    0
  • Unanswered invites:
    0
About the client
Member since Aug 19, 2012
  • United States
    Chicago3:58 AM
  • $626K total spent
    346 hires, 21 active
  • 24,518 hours
  • Health & Fitness
    Mid-sized company (10-99 people)

Explore similar jobs on Upwork

Build Agentic AI EngineHourly‐ Posted 9 months ago
Artificial Intelligence
AI Agent Development
AI Implementation
Chatbot Development

How it works

  • Post a job icon
    Create your free profile
    Highlight your skills and experience, show your portfolio, and set your ideal pay rate.
  • Talent comes to you icon
    Work the way you want
    Apply for jobs, create easy-to-by projects, or access exclusive opportunities that come to you.
  • Payment simplified icon
    Get paid securely
    From contract to payment, we help you work safely and get paid securely.
Want to get started? Create a profile

About Upwork

  • Rating is 4.9 out of 5.
    4.9/5
    (Average rating of clients by professionals)
  • G2 2021
    #1 freelance platform
  • 49,000+
    Signed contract every week
  • $2.3B
    Freelancers earned on Upwork in 2020

Find the best freelance jobs

Growing your career is as easy as creating a free profile and finding work like this that fits your skills.

Trusted by

  • Microsoft Logo
  • Airbnb Logo
  • Bissell Logo
  • GoDaddy Logo